I don't get how having a cool notebook translates into a battery that doesn't blow up. As far as I remember, the whole battery recall was because of a slight possibility of an internal short in LiIon cells. This had everything to do with manufacturing process and perhaps gravity, and nothing at all to do with the rest of the notebook. To suggest that these products avoided the recall because of their design is ignorant. They avoided the recall because they sourced different batteries.
Granted, a cooler notebook will result in longer batteries, since heat will reduce the effective capacity over time. That is the only advantage, from a power standpoint.
